Output 058704cb339ee964eefa8255d5e630f09570cf8ab3666a0b35bad5d9b338387a:1

value
704029518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c53c8ef13aeec8d7ab110f2cf2674dcc1da27171 OP_EQUAL
address
MRt3tta9fXZLFZqyYppZKqKprQtKRFwdpK
transaction
058704cb339ee964eefa8255d5e630f09570cf8ab3666a0b35bad5d9b338387a
spent
true